If You Want to be a Great Speaker,              First Learn to be a Great Listener.

 

You can’t be a great speaker unless you’re also a great listener.  That’s because the best speakers are always speaking directly to the needs of the audience.   And often the only way to learn those needs is to ask and then listen.
